SHIPTALK: The International Association Of Classification Societies (IACS)

Over 90% of the world’s merchant shipping tonnage is classified by the 12 member societies of the International Association of Classification Societies (IACS).

Dedicated to safe ships and clean seas, IACS makes a unique contribution to maritime safety and regulation through technical support, compliance verification and research and development.

IACS was formed in 1968 to promote high standards in safety, prevent pollution and liaise closely with the shipping industry and organisations.

IACS members classify many ships, and most international administrations use the IACS members’ rules and regulations as the basis of their fleet’s license to operate, including compliance with mandatory requirements. The members conduct surveys annually and play an active part in the workings of the IMO.

It has a voice in the development of international conventions and also in providing technical support to member states of the IMO. IACS eliminates substandard ships and increases the sophistication of ship design and operations. IACS members include ABS (US of A), BV (France), CCS (China), CRS (Croatia), DNV GL (Germany), IRS (India), KR (South Korea), LR (UK), PRS (Poland), RINA (Italy), RS (Russia) and ClassNK (Japan).

The Contribution of IACS

With its extensive knowledge of the industry and fleet, IACS contributes to international shipping and regulations, depending on the input from members. Although it is a non-governmental organisation, it holds a consultative status with the IMO and regularly participates in the capacity of an observer as well as an adviser to the IMO and the member states. This includes participation in the Maritime Safety Committee (MSC), Maritime Environment Protection Committee (MEPC), International Safety Management (ISM), as well as any other sub-committees and such.

IACS had a vital role in the implementation of ISM, a mainstay in the shipping industry today, wherein IACS developed guidelines and provided interpretations of the ISM Code. Having the majority of the world’s fleet under its purview and the extensive knowledge associated with it, IACS also enables cooperation with the Port State Control (PSC) to ensure high quality in the maritime field.
